Output 3c24085690f87405e03b98fa17fb0c4f56d9304d0e14db607f169f9a50388718:0

value
21694188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12baa08504e07516e94f1d441c60a8a41eac13b7 OP_EQUAL
address
M9cBxxRsv77dfCbsTdTSFZY2aa6qJhtbMp
transaction
3c24085690f87405e03b98fa17fb0c4f56d9304d0e14db607f169f9a50388718
spent
true